Attending to Motovun: Your Journey to the Coronary heart of Istria
There isn’t a airport, rail station, or bus station, for that matter, in Motovun. Croatia affords bus and rail providers, however they’re restricted. The best choice is flying into Pula, renting a automobile, and driving an hour, totally on a four-lane toll highway, to Motovun.
You might additionally fly to Zagreb or Ljubljana (Slovenia). Driving from Ljubljana takes about two hours, whereas Zagreb is roughly three hours away. From Trieste, Italy, the drive takes two hours, and from Venice, it’s about three. Ferries function alongside the Croatian coast and from Italy, reaching Istrian cities like Poreč, Rovinj, and Pula, the place you possibly can hire a automobile.
I like to recommend flying to Pula, renting a automobile, taking the toll highway north, after which the brief two-lane highway to Motovun. Drive fastidiously on the two-lane roads as cyclists typically share the route, and so they have the proper of means. Motovun sits on a hill, and its slender cobblestone streets are principally pedestrian-only. Guests typically park within the well-lit lot on the backside of the hill and take a shuttle bus to the city. From there, it’s a brief stroll over uneven cobblestones into the middle.
Croatia’s hilly terrain means you’ll typically be navigating slopes, so take care with curler luggage and watch your step. If wanted, your resort, B&B, or condo host could decide you up on the parking zone—simply prepare a time upfront.

Croatian Wines
Croatian beer is sweet, however Croatian wines are spectacular and really moderately priced. So, after all, we all the time had a bottle for lunch and one other bottle for dinner, to separate. Motovun eating places principally serve native whites and reds. Malvazija is a superb white and a sensible choice for lunch. For dinner, an area purple made with Teran grapes was our favorite with its full-bodied, gentle blended fruit flavours.
The day we left, we made it a degree to cease on the Fakin Vineyard, just some miles from Motovun, for a tasting of their malvasia, Teran, and different wines. This was effectively definitely worth the cease. A bunch of liquors are served all through Croatia with Motovun providing some native apple brandy that’s good to high off a night.
